This is a specialist disclaimer template, that may be suitable for use on a website that provides legal information, such as information about legislation, case law, legal theory and/or legal practice.

The disclaimer asserts that the legal information published on the website is just that – legal information and not legal advice. It asserts that no warranties or representations are given in relation to the legal information. And it seeks to exclude any liabilities that may arise out of the use or misuse of the information.The disclaimer may be incorporated into a general legal notice, or used on its own. The contents of this legal advice disclaimer are as follows: (1) no advice, (2) credit, (3) no warranties, (4) no lawyer-client relationship, (5) interactive features, (6) professional assistance, (7) limiting our liability.Note: the courts generally view disclaimers of liability with disfavour, and have at their disposal a range of conceptual tools to limit the effects of disclaimers. You should not rely upon any document that seeks to exclude or limit liability except upon legal advice. Even if you take legal advice, the advice you receive may well be heavily caveated.

Top Public & Private Colleges in Irvine CA

Irvine, California is a hub for academic excellence, offering students access to highly ranked public and private colleges and universities. Known for its innovation and safety, Irvine provides an exceptional environment for higher learning across various fields such as science, technology, business, and the arts.

Top Public Colleges & Universities in Irvine

University of California, Irvine (UCI) – UCI is a top-tier public research university recognized nationally for its strengths in biology, computer science, engineering, and business. It is part of the prestigious University of California system and is known for its commitment to innovation and public service.

Irvine Valley College – This community college offers excellent transfer programs to the UC and CSU systems, along with vocational training and associate degree programs. It is known for its high academic standards and personalized student support.

Coastline College – Irvine Center – Located in nearby Fountain Valley with classes offered in Irvine, Coastline College serves adult learners and traditional students with flexible courses in business, computer information systems, and general education.

Orange Coast College – Satellite Locations in Irvine – While based in Costa Mesa, Orange Coast College offers programs and classes accessible to students in Irvine, known for its strong arts, culinary, and technology programs.

California State University, Fullerton – Irvine Center – This satellite campus of CSU Fullerton offers programs in business administration, teaching, and public administration, providing convenient access for Irvine residents seeking a high-quality public education.

Top Private Colleges & Universities in Irvine

Concordia University Irvine – A faith-based private university offering undergraduate and graduate degrees in liberal arts, education, theology, and business. Concordia is known for its supportive learning community and commitment to Christian values.

Westcliff University – A fast-growing private institution offering degrees in business, education, technology, and law. Westcliff emphasizes real-world experience and flexible online and in-person learning formats.

Stanbridge University – Irvine Campus – Specializing in healthcare and nursing education, Stanbridge University is well-regarded for its advanced simulation labs and high licensure exam pass rates in programs like nursing, occupational therapy, and veterinary technology.

University of Massachusetts Global – Irvine Campus – Formerly Brandman University, this private, non-profit university is tailored to working adults, offering flexible online and on-campus programs in business, psychology, education, and public administration.

California Southern University – An accredited online university headquartered in Irvine, offering degrees in psychology, business, law, and criminal justice. It is known for its flexible schedules and personalized support for adult learners.

Professional Sports Teams in Irvine CA

Irvine, California does not currently host any major professional sports teams within the city itself. However, its strategic location in Orange County places it near a number of prominent teams across multiple leagues in neighboring cities like Anaheim and Los Angeles. Irvine is also active in sports through college athletics and hosts several professional training facilities and events.

🎓 College Sports – UC Irvine Anteaters (NCAA)

  • UC Irvine Anteaters – Competing in NCAA Division I, the Anteaters represent the University of California, Irvine across many sports, including basketball, baseball, soccer, and volleyball. The men's volleyball team has been especially successful, winning four national championships (2007, 2009, 2012, 2013).

⚾ Nearby Baseball – Los Angeles Angels (MLB)

  • Los Angeles Angels – Based in Anaheim, just a short drive from Irvine, the Angels are the closest MLB team. They won their only World Series title in 2002 and have featured legendary players like Mike Trout and Shohei Ohtani.

🏒 Nearby Hockey – Anaheim Ducks (NHL)

  • Anaheim Ducks – The Ducks play at the Honda Center in Anaheim and are the nearest NHL team to Irvine. Founded in 1993, they became the first California team to win a Stanley Cup in 2007.

⚽ Soccer Training Ground – Orange County SC (USL Championship)

  • Orange County SC – Competing in the USL Championship, Orange County SC plays at Championship Soccer Stadium in the Great Park in Irvine. They have been developing young talent and building a fan base in Southern California since their founding.

🏀 Pro Training & Tournaments

  • Irvine regularly hosts elite-level youth tournaments and training camps for various sports, including basketball, soccer, and volleyball. Some NBA and MLS players use Irvine’s facilities, such as those at the Great Park and Spectrum Sports Complex, for offseason training.

While Irvine may not yet have a major league team of its own, the city offers easy access to a wide variety of professional sports events and is an active participant in the Southern California sports scene.
